    Western Australia's oldest observatory is located 25km east of Perth in Bickley. The Observatory has served WA for 119 years and remains actively involved in the service of public education. In recognition of its scientific, cultural and historical significance, the Observatory was entered on the state's Heritage Register in 2005.     The rowing division at Champion Lakes Boating Club was formed in July 2008 and is the youngest rowing club in the state. It is unique in being the only club in the state with a primary presence at the Champion Lakes Regatta Centre - an international standard facility for rowing, kayaking and dragon boating.
